A member asked:

After biopsy if it seems that lump is stuck to the walls of breast and has a continous pain then what's wrong?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Needs to be checked: If you are having continuos pain following a biopsy for a breast mass.It may be due to bleeding or an infection.I will suggest you make an appointment with the breast doctor and get checked.You can put ice locally and take some pain meds till you see the doctor
